gpt4 book ai didi

asp.net-mvc - 在 SharePoint 2013 可视化 Web 部件中使用 Razor 引擎

转载 作者:行者123 更新时间:2023-12-04 15:59:22 24 4
gpt4 key购买 nike

我正在尝试在 SharePoint 2013 Web 部件中使用 Razor 引擎。我读到这应该不会太难,因为可以使用 .NET Framework 4.0 构建 SharePoint 2013 可视化 Web 部件

我只是不确定从哪里开始这样做。我看过一篇关于上传.cshtml的文章文件到文档库并在 Web 部件中引用文档库,但有点不清楚。

有谁知道我该如何开始?或者向我指出实现我所追求的目标的分步指南。

我的最终目标是:获取 MVC 应用程序的一部分,对其进行自定义并使其成为 Web 部件。我需要能够修改或访问该站点上的 SharePoint 内容,这就是我无法使用应用程序部件的原因。

最佳答案

好的。

首先安装 Office 开发模板

http://www.microsoft.com/visualstudio/eng/office-dev-tools-for-visual-studio

这将在重新打开 Studio 时为您提供以下模板选择

VS Office and Sharepoint Templates

然后导航到 EwsManagedApi32.msi 所在的任何位置,并在提升的提示中输入以下命令 -

EwsManagedApi32.msi addlocal="ExchangeWebServicesApi_Feature,ExchangeWebServicesApi_Gac"

现在您的模板可用,您想要的是“VS2012 Web 部件”。

现在,默认情况下这会添加一个 ASP.NET 项目,这不是你想要的,所以手动删除 ASP.NET 项目,添加一个 MVC 项目,在解决方案资源管理器中突出显示 SharePoint 项目,点击 F4,然后选择 MVC 项目在属性底部的“Web 项目”下拉列表中。

你去吧。每个 Web 部件一个 Controller ,已排序。

关于asp.net-mvc - 在 SharePoint 2013 可视化 Web 部件中使用 Razor 引擎,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16406607/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com